Understanding Your Main Sewer Line: Inspections and Upkeep Tips
Your main sewer line is the backbone of your home's drainage system, transporting wastewater away from your property. It's essential to understand how this vital component works and take proactive steps to ensure its smooth function. Regular inspections can help identify potential problems early on, preventing costly repairs down the road. Schedule a professional inspection at least once every few years to examine the condition of your sewer line. Look for signs of damage, such as slow drainage, foul odors, or recurring sewage backups, and address them promptly.
To keep your main sewer line in tip-top shape, consider these upkeep tips: Avoid flushing anything other than toilet paper down the drains. Invest in a drain strainer to catch debris and hair that can clog pipes. Be mindful of what you pour down the sink, as grease and solvents can build up and block flow. Regularly clean your sewer line by flushing it with a mixture of water and baking soda or using a professional hydro jetting service to remove buildup.
- Proactive maintenance is key to avoiding costly repairs down the road.
- By understanding your main sewer line and implementing these tips, you can ensure a properly functioning drainage system for your home.
